## Formula sandbox tuning

User-supplied formulas in Gridmoor execute inside a restricted interpreter with hard ceilings on time, memory, and call depth. Reviewers should confirm any change to these ceilings is justified in the PR description, since raising them widens the abuse surface. Defaults were chosen from production traces. The current limits are as follows.

limits module of tafog-fawip:
WEIGHTS = {
    "julix": 57,
    "lamys": 992,
    "kasvan": 209,
    "quenok": 750,
    "alddor": 259,
    "oliath": 1009,
    "wenix": 815,
}

## Onboarding — Fernlock config hot-reload

Fernlock watches its env file and reloads on write; no restart. Reviewer notes: reloads are atomic, validated before apply, and rejected configs log a diff with secrets redacted. Only the ops group can write the file. Reload events are audit-logged with the editor's identity. Rotation therefore means editing the file in place and waiting one tick. Keep keys alphabetized; the watcher ignores comments. The service's reload-signing credential is the last entry and appears on the next line.

env line for fafof-fahag: LEDGER_TOKEN5=f8790

# Tidemark Scheduler — Environments

Covers the calendar sync service behind Tidemark. Three environments: dev, staging, prod. Staging currently shows a sync conflict: recurring events from the Fernhollow tenant double-book against prod mirrors because both poll the same upstream feed. Fix in flight — staging will get its own feed token this week. Do not promote builds until the conflict clears. Prod is unaffected. For the eng sync, the relevant environment settings are as follows.

service settings:
PRAIX_LOG_LEVEL=error
PRAIX_METRICS_HOST=metrics.praix.qorvelcorp.corp
PRAIX_POOL_SIZE=16